Understanding BLDC Motor Technology
A BLDC motor is an electric motor that uses electronic commutation instead of traditional brushes and mechanical commutators. This design eliminates friction caused by brush contact, allowing the motor to operate more efficiently with reduced wear and longer service life.
Compared with conventional brushed motors, BLDC motors offer many advantages, including higher energy efficiency, quieter operation, better speed regulation, and improved durability. These features make them ideal for applications requiring continuous operation and precise control.

Advanced Manufacturing Capabilities
Producing high-quality BLDC motors requires advanced production technology and strict process control. Professional manufacturers use precision machining equipment, automated assembly lines, advanced winding technology, and comprehensive testing systems to ensure consistent motor quality.
The manufacturing process involves multiple stages, including component production, stator assembly, rotor balancing, coil winding, magnet installation, and final performance testing. Each step must meet strict standards to ensure reliability and efficiency.
Modern BLDC motor manufacturers also use simulation software and digital design tools to analyze motor performance before production. This helps engineers improve thermal management, reduce energy losses, and develop optimized solutions for specific applications.

Applications of BLDC Motors
BLDC motors are widely used across various industries. In electric transportation, they provide efficient power for electric bicycles, scooters, and vehicles. In robotics and automation, they enable accurate movement and reliable operation.
Consumer electronics manufacturers use BLDC motors in products such as air conditioners, cooling fans, vacuum cleaners, and smart appliances because of their energy-saving benefits. In healthcare equipment, BLDC motors support quiet and stable performance for critical applications.
